Penjana frekuensi ultra rendah dan voltan tinggi ialah produk teras yang dibangunkan secara bebas dengan menggunakan teknologi terkini di Amerika Syarikat. Ia menggunakan skrin sentuh 7-inci, mikrokomputer cip tunggal ARM7 terkini, litar pemerolehan AD berkelajuan tinggi dan perisian pengurusan latar belakang. Ia mempunyai ciri-ciri bunyi rendah, penjimatan tenaga, gelombang sinus bentuk gelombang voltan tinggi, kekutuban suis elektronik voltan tinggi dan sebagainya.

Pengenalan Titik Jualan Produk

 

  1. 1. Teknologi lanjutan: teknologi penukaran frekuensi digital, kawalan mikrokomputer, kenaikan tekanan, pengurangan tekanan, pengukuran, perlindungan, dsb.
    2. Proses ujian adalah automatik sepenuhnya.
    3. Mudah dikendalikan: pendawaian mudah, operasi bodoh.
    4. Perlindungan menyeluruh: perlindungan berganda (perlindungan lebihan voltan, perlindungan arus lebih pada sisi voltan tinggi dan rendah), tindakan pantas (apabila bertindak)
    5. Bilik ≤10ms), instrumen ini selamat dan boleh dipercayai.
    6. Keselamatan dan kebolehpercayaan: pengawal disambungkan dengan voltan rendah penjana voltan tinggi, dengan kawalan fotoelektrik, penggunaan yang selamat dan boleh dipercayai.
    7. Litar kawalan maklum balas negatif gelung tertutup voltan tinggi dan rendah diguna pakai, dan output tidak mempunyai kesan kenaikan kapasiti.
    8. Konfigurasi lengkap: skrin sentuh kapasitif, paparan aksara Cina LCD, storan automatik, percetakan automatik.
    9. Julat ujian besar: 0.1Hz, 0.05Hz dan 0.02hz pemilihan berbilang frekuensi, julat ujian yang besar.
    10. Jumlah kecil dan ringan: ia adalah sangat mudah untuk operasi luar.

A line impedance tester, also known as a cable impedance analyzer, is a device used to measure the characteristic impedance of coaxial cables, twisted pair cables, and other transmission lines. Impedance, measured in ohms, represents the opposition to the flow of alternating current. Maintaining the correct impedance (typically 50 or 75 ohms) is vital for minimizing signal reflections, ensuring efficient power transfer, and preventing signal degradation. Mismatched impedance can lead to signal loss, ghosting, and reduced network performance. Regular testing helps identify faults and maintain network integrity.
